A small coastal hotel in the village of Neos Panteleimon overlooking the famous Mount Olympus. Situated on its own beach. The rooms were updated in 2011. The hotel is perfect for an economical family, romantic and relaxing holiday.More →

We spent our vacation in the summer at the Ocean Hotel, near Olympus. The hotel was chosen for a short time, but stopped there. Family hotel, hospitable, helpful people. Good service. The hotel was chosen for a short time, but stopped there. Family hotel, hospitable, helpful people. Good service. They were delighted with the food, the hotel has its own tavern, so during the day there was no need to go anywhere from the hotel. Always fresh seafood. The hotel area is small, but cozy enough and equipped with its own beach. I always choose a hotel near the beach, so here it is.... you leave the hotel, a few steps and you are in the sea.... In the evening we walked around the village where the hotel is located, it is called Paralia Panteleimon. The village is small, with small shops and shops. We rode on a train that goes to the neighboring village of Platamonas, after seven o'clock in the evening it starts its route, the price per person is 3 euros there and back. The sea in this region has a wide coastline, fine sand and the entrance to the sea is sand, but with pebbles. We rested on our last vacation in Halkidiki, there were many impressions, but due to old age and remoteness from the main attractions, we did not go on many excursions. For this purpose, in order to still visit Meteora and Olympus, they chose this region and were not mistaken. More in love with this country. Now seriously thinking about buying property in Greece. We look after the region and get acquainted with the prices.

I wanted to relax, swim and, of course, treat myself to Greek cuisine, the memories of which I have preserved since 1985, when I happened to taste them for the first time.
And now we are already in Thessaloniki, and after 2 hours we get off the bus at the door of the Ocean Hotel.
A small hall, a counter, on it a bunch of keys to the rooms, lucky people in bathing suits pass by. We are humbly waiting, because it’s only 10 am, and the settlement is after 2 pm. It doesn’t even take 10 minutes, when a young man with a beard appears, as it turned out, one of the owners of the hotel, Dimitros, takes our voucher, compares it with something, chooses the key from the room, picks up our suitcases and, cheerfully slapping the stairs with bare feet, invites us to follow him. To the second floor, where we are settled, a white marble staircase leads, absolutely clean at any time of the day.
We get a good room with standard furniture, bright, spacious, with a large bathroom with radiant clean sanitary ware, a refrigerator mounted almost under the ceiling, a TV. The beds turned out to be very comfortable, our spines felt great on them. Regularly changed bed linen and towels were always snow-white. A cozy balcony overlooking the hotel's beach, and of course the sea. There is a round table and 2 chairs on the balcony. Everywhere is very clean.
The hotel area is quite small, but very cozy, arranged so that everyone is comfortable. The green lawn is protected from the sun by a decorative crown of trees, with which the thatched roof of the bar goes well.
A small beach with umbrellas full of sunbeds, and everything is free. The beach is sand and small pebbles, a soft descent into the sea, clear water. You can order drinks at the bar that you can bring directly to the beach, but this is already for the money. Between the sun beds there are small "bedside tables" with recesses for bottles, glasses and urns, filled in the evening, already empty in the morning. Music plays in the background on the beach all day. There is a ping-pong table, a volleyball court, including
WiFi. Now in one corner, then in another corner, someone is sitting with a laptop.
Our room was located above the restaurant, and every morning we were awakened by the smell of freshly brewed coffee. Barely waiting for breakfast time, we hurried down. The breakfast is European, plentiful, with indispensable olives, each the size of a good plum, freshly baked croissants, Greek yogurt. Hearty, delicious .
Dinner began with soup, which was poured by the chef himself. We did not try everything, but there were no tasteless ones. Then the torment began, since this cook cooked very tasty, I wanted to try, if not all, then we aspired to this, but we couldn’t. For 10 days, there was no repetition in the set of dishes. Traditional were only a village salad, the one that we call Greek, and olives.
By the way, in this salad, the Greeks do not cut the feta into small pieces, but put it on top of the vegetables in one large piece. Seafood, fish, meat of all kinds and in different ways, potatoes in completely unusual versions, vegetables, often grilled.
The dinner was completed with the indispensable watermelon and melon, and then a walk through, as we called it, our village.
When we dined at the hotel restaurant, the dessert was a bonus.
Any of our requests met with full understanding, in which we were actively helped by the hotel guide Mouzenidis - Nina, a sweet, very friendly young woman.
With her help, we not only enjoyed the sea and Greek cuisine, but also climbed Mount Olympus, wandered around the ancient Dias, saw the armor of Philip II in Vergen, swam in the rain in the pool with thermal water. But, most importantly, we were in the monasteries on Meteora, the impression of visiting which cannot be compared with anything else. And we were also lucky that Maryana was the guide on this trip.
Both me and my companion liked the hotel. We are glad that "Oceana" lived up to our expectations. Clean, cozy, comfortable, tasty, the owners, maids, waiters simply radiate goodwill and are already beginning to understand Russian. Greeks are resting, many Kievans , married couples, often with children, even up to a year. In a small parking lot of the hotel cars with numbers of different countries.
We advised our friends and acquaintances to choose Oceana Hotel, located in Neos Panteleimonas, for a holiday in Greece.
